Embryo

An early stage of development for multicellular organisms following fertilization, during which the organism undergoes division and growth.

Paternal Age

Paternal age refers to the age of a father at the time of his child's birth, which research indicates can influence genetic mutations and the risk of certain disorders in offspring.

Schizophrenia

A chronic and severe mental disorder that affects how a person thinks, feels, and behaves, often leading to hallucinations, delusions, and disordered thinking.
